Novak Djokovic deported from Australia after losing legal battle

Novak Djokovic was deported from Australia after losing the legal battle over his coronavirus vaccination status.

Djokovic will no longer be able to defend his Autralian Open title after the court verdict.

An “extremely disappointed” Djokovic said he would comply with a unanimous Federal Court decision.

“I cannot stay in Australia and participate in the Australian Open,” he said on the eve of a tournament that he has dominated for a decade.

“I hope that we can all now focus on the game and tournament I love.”

“The orders of the court are that the amended application be dismissed with costs,” Allsop said in understated remarks that ended a week of legal high drama.

“Three Federal Court justices had listened to half a day of feisty legal back-and-forth about Djokovic’s alleged risk to public order in Australia.”
